Zydus Lifesciences (NSE:ZYDUSLIFE): What Does USFDA Final Approval for Indocyanine Green Mean?

Zydus Lifesciences Limited (NSE:ZYDUSLIFE) announced on 4 August 2026 that it has received final approval from the USFDA for its ANDA for Indocyanine Green for Injection, USP, 25 mg/vial, carrying 180-day Competitive Generic Therapy exclusivity, with a commercial launch in the United States planned shortly.

Key Highlights

  • The USFDA granted final approval for Zydus Lifesciences' ANDA for Indocyanine Green for Injection, USP, 25 mg/vial, a sterile lyophilised powder for reconstitution.
  • The USFDA has designated the application a Competitive Generic Therapy, making the product eligible for 180-day CGT exclusivity beginning from the date of first commercial marketing.
  • The product is the generic equivalent of IC-Green by Diagnostic Green LLC, whose US annual brand sales stood at approximately USD 125.8 million, a growth of 61.0%, as per IQVIA MAT June 2026 data.
  • Manufacturing will be carried out at the group's USFDA-approved injectable plant at Jarod, near Vadodara, Gujarat, and the product will be marketed in the US by Zydus Pharmaceuticals (USA) Inc.

About the Company

Zydus Lifesciences Limited, listed on NSE under the ticker ZYDUSLIFE and headquartered in Ahmedabad, Gujarat, is an innovative global life sciences company that discovers, develops, manufactures, and markets a broad range of healthcare therapies. The group employs over 30,000 people worldwide, including approximately 1,500 scientists in research and development, and operates across pharmaceuticals, biologicals, vaccines, and new chemical entities, serving patients in the United States, India, and other international markets.

Announcement in Detail

The USFDA's final approval covers Zydus Lifesciences' ANDA for Indocyanine Green for Injection, USP, 25 mg/vial, formulated as a sterile lyophilised green powder supplied as a kit with single-dose vials of Sterile Water for Injection, 10 ml. The product is indicated for fluorescence imaging of vessels, blood flow, tissue perfusion, extrahepatic biliary ducts, lymph nodes, and lymphatic vessels, and for ophthalmic angiography, in adults and paediatric patients aged one month and older for certain indications.

The USFDA designated the application a Competitive Generic Therapy. The 180-day CGT exclusivity period, where applicable, runs from the date of first commercial marketing as determined by the USFDA. The reference listed drug, IC-Green by Diagnostic Green LLC, recorded US annual brand sales of approximately USD 125.8 million, representing 61.0% value growth and volume growth of 27.1%, totalling 0.64 million units, per IQVIA MAT June 2026 data. As of 30 June 2026, Zydus holds 445 USFDA approvals from 513 ANDAs filed.

Impact on Investors

The filing shows that the 180-day CGT exclusivity, where it applies, provides a defined period during which Zydus faces limited generic competition for Indocyanine Green for Injection in the United States. Investors will note that the exclusivity period is triggered by the date of first commercial marketing, and the announcement states a launch is planned shortly, though no specific launch date has been confirmed in the filing.

Shareholders will observe that the brand market for the reference drug recorded approximately USD 125.8 million in annual US sales as of IQVIA MAT June 2026, providing context for the addressable opportunity. The disclosed terms indicate the product adds to Zydus' complex injectable and imaging agent portfolio, which the company has identified as a continued area of investment.

Sector / Market Context

The US generic pharmaceuticals market is shaped significantly by USFDA designations such as Competitive Generic Therapy, introduced under the FDA Reauthorization Act of 2017 to accelerate generic entry in markets with limited competition. Indocyanine Green is an established optical imaging agent used in minimally invasive surgical procedures, a segment that has expanded alongside growth in laparoscopic and robotic surgical volumes in the United States.
